#941c94 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#941c94 is composed of 58% red, 11% green and 58%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 81.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 42% black. It has a hue angle of 300 degrees, a saturation of 68.2% and a lightness of 34.5%. #941c94 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ff38ff with #290029. Closest websafe color is: #993399.

Shades and Tints of #941c94
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#100310 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#941c94
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5e525e is the less saturated color, while #af01af is the most saturated one.
